David Green recommended the speed bleeders to me last year and I'm just now getting around to doing them.

I'll let you know what I think of them.

I boiled my brake fluid at Buttonwillow a few weekends ago ( I should have changed it before I went but didnt').  The speed bleeders should make bleeding the brakes it easier and quicker - maybe I'll do it next time!

I'm also considering a front brake cooling duct kit from Parts Rack - which should help on hot days.
